Bug Description

Checkbox allows the user to skip any manual test they are presented with, however the only way to feed back the reason for that action is through a comment attached to the test and this is obviously something that the user has to take a conscious decision to do. It would be better if the skipping process encoded some concrete reason why a test was skipped. The options below are suggested:

* I don't have the required external device for this test (e.g. USB stick, Bluetooth Headset)
* The system I am testing does not have the required hardware/port for this test.
* Other (in this case a reason must be specified using the freeform comment field.
